Thanks 👍Bobs runs was .10 of a second for all three shots. My best was .12 that's 20% slower!
Bob was amazing he could split cards, shoot coins out of the air and pull off amazing long shots with pistols. But his triple shots were with blanks to show how fast the gun could run.
Almost makes it seem like the single action army has a selector switch with a burst setting. That speed never ceases to amaze!
The mechanical aspect is as amazing to me as the shooting. The controls are the same as they were in 1873. The gun is just slicked up and lightened and reenforced to take the stress.

I have a question for you, what is the AVERAGE cost of a good used race gun these days, I remember a video in which you said you came upon one in a pawn shop I believe, while rare I surmise there their out their, so in your experience what is you estimation of a good race gun price, used. By the way, D**M impressive shooting by all and Mr Munden was absolutely amazing and is the all around king of the six gun no doubt, sadly missed, carry on with your work, it’s a treasure and something to behold.
Thanks for the nice comment. The first race gun I ran across was priced around 2500 to my memory and was an odd looking piece imo. My impression was someone was trying to dump a bad build. The second one I ran across was 850 and looked indenticle to the Munden race gun I had built to my memory 30 years before. I bought it and it was not without problems but it would run like a stolen corvette until parts started to wear. I reverse engineered it and learned to build my own SAA race guns (no small task). Now I can buy a Pietta Great Western 2 and convert it into a SAA race gun in about 8 tedious hours of work.

Super cool stuff I enjoy every split second of it! What is you favorite single action caliber? How is 9mm in a single action?
9mm and 38 are lighter recoil but a heavier gun that's slower on the draw. 45 is faster out of the holster but harder to handle because it's more powerful and a lighter gun. So it's a dilemma.
